Recognizing Symptoms: When Does Your Pet Need a Mobile Vet?

Knowing which signs warrant a call to a mobile veterinarian can help you act quickly and confidently. A wide range of symptoms can be effectively assessed and managed by a mobile vet, especially when early intervention matters most.

Key symptoms that mobile veterinarians commonly address include persistent itching, red or irritated skin, mild ear infections, sneezing, coughing that isn’t severe, vomiting or diarrhea that lasts less than 24 hours, and changes in appetite or energy that are not accompanied by collapse or severe distress. Additionally, issues such as limping, minor wounds, lumps or bumps, bad breath, and dental tartar are frequently managed during in-home visits. If your senior pet is slowing down or showing signs of arthritis, a mobile vet can evaluate mobility changes and discuss pain management options, all in a familiar setting.

Pets with anxiety or those who dislike traveling often benefit the most from at-home care. For example, a cat hiding under the bed during thunderstorms or a dog trembling on car rides is less likely to experience stress when cared for at home. Understanding the Causes: Why Do These Symptoms Occur?

Many pet symptoms have straightforward explanations—some are minor, while others may signal underlying health concerns. Skin problems, for instance, can arise from environmental allergies, flea infestations, or dietary sensitivities. Digestive upsets, such as vomiting or diarrhea, are often caused by dietary indiscretion (eating something unusual), abrupt food changes, mild infections, or stress.

Ear infections may develop due to moisture, wax buildup, or allergies, while dental issues like tartar and gum redness result from plaque accumulation and lack of routine dental care. Mobility issues in older pets are frequently related to arthritis or soft tissue injuries, especially in breeds prone to joint problems.

The home environment in Bluffton and the Lowcountry region can contribute to certain symptoms. Warm, humid weather allows fleas and ticks to thrive, and seasonal pollen peaks may trigger skin or respiratory allergies in pets. Treatment and Management: What Can a Mobile Vet Handle?

One of the greatest advantages of choosing a mobile veterinarian is the wide range of treatments and diagnostics available right in your living room or backyard. Fetch A Vet’s team of veterinary professionals can perform thorough wellness examinations, administer vaccinations, draw blood for laboratory testing, and use portable digital radiology equipment for on-site imaging. If your pet has an ear infection, the veterinarian can examine the ear, collect samples, and prescribe appropriate medication on the spot.

Skin issues are often addressed with allergy consultations, topical treatments, or recommendations for environmental changes. When gastrointestinal symptoms are mild, a mobile vet can recommend dietary adjustments, prescribe anti-nausea or anti-diarrheal medications, and monitor your pet’s progress. Dental health can also be managed through in-home evaluations, with professional cleanings or extractions scheduled as needed. While mobile veterinary teams can manage a remarkable spectrum of conditions, there are limits. If your pet requires surgery beyond routine spay or neuter, or needs intensive hospitalization, a referral to a specialty clinic may be recommended. Prevention and Home Care: Keeping Your Pet Healthy Between Visits

Preventing illness is always easier than treating it. Many mobile vet visits focus on preventive care, helping you keep your pet healthy all year long. Wellness care in Bluffton and surrounding communities includes regular physical exams, up-to-date vaccinations, parasite prevention tailored to local risks, and nutritional counseling. Maintaining a clean home environment, avoiding abrupt changes in diet, and providing regular dental care all contribute to your pet’s overall health.

If your pet is prone to allergies, routine cleaning of bedding, vacuuming carpets, and using flea preventatives can reduce the risk of flare-ups. For pets with arthritis or mobility issues, keeping floors slip-free, providing orthopedic bedding, and ensuring gentle exercise can enhance comfort at home. When minor symptoms do arise, monitoring your pet’s behavior and keeping a symptom diary can help your veterinarian track changes and adjust care as needed.

When to Seek Professional Veterinary Care: Mobile vs. Clinic

Knowing when to call a mobile vet is just as important as recognizing what can be managed at home. Situations that are well-suited for a mobile veterinarian include mild to moderate symptoms that do not involve severe pain, collapse, uncontrolled bleeding, or sudden paralysis. Examples are minor wounds, mild vomiting or diarrhea, skin irritation, or new lumps that are not rapidly growing.

However, there are times when immediate clinic care is essential. Warning signs that always require a trip to a veterinary hospital include difficulty breathing, persistent vomiting or diarrhea lasting more than a day, seizures, severe trauma, loss of consciousness, or inability to urinate. If your pet experiences these symptoms, seek emergency care right away.
